In April of 2003 the Lord gave Reverend Michael Neely a vision for a new and different kind of church. It would be a New Testament church that would become a lighthouse in a place of darkness. Its sole purpose would be to glorify God and win lost men and women to the Lord Jesus Christ.

Thus New Millennium Community Churched was birthed on Sunday September 19th, 2004 in the cafeteria of Paul Mort Elementary school. Since its inception, NMCC has met at 5 locations, all the while maintaining the desire to be a vibrant church where the truth of the Gospel could be clearly and creatively communicated to the surrounding community.

We belong to a multicultural denomination known as the

“Christian and Missionary Alliance”.

Formed as a cross-denominational missions society in the 1880’s, The Alliance evolved into a world evangelization movement in the early 20th century and became an evangelical missions and church-planting denomination in 1974.

While pastoring a Presbyterian congregation in New York City in 1881, C&MA founder, Dr. A.B. Simpson, witnessed the physical and spiritual plight of the city’s homeless, downtrodden and infirmed, and of its disenfranchised immigrant populations. This daily exposure moved Simpson to devote his life and ministry to taking the whole gospel to the whole world.

Having experienced the all-sufficiency of Christ on a deeply personal level, Simpson articulated a core theology, proclaiming Jesus as Savior, Sanctifier, Healer and Coming King. This “Fourfold Gospel” remains the spiritual foundation of The Alliance, the “deeper life” engine that drives us toward the completion of the Great Commission (Matthew 28:18-20).

Today, there are more than 2,000 Alliance churches in the United States, and approximately 18,000 fellowships in 81 countries around the world, where nearly 5 million Christians call themselves “Alliance”, united by an unquenchable passion to provide access to the gospel where no access yet exists.
